Should a negative battery cable spark?

Should a negative battery cable spark? The battery cables can spark if the cables are installed in the improper order. When attaching the battery cables, place the positive cable on first and then the ground cable. Also, the ground, or negative cable, should not be touching anything metal while the positive cable is hooked up. What was the problem with my Ford Mustang battery? Why are V10 engines bad?

Why are V10 engines bad? Pre-2002 V10 Triton engines have an unfortunate design flaw within the cylinder head and spark plug designs that can cause the plugs to actually eject out of cylinder head, or weld themselves to it. The Triton V10 engines used a cast iron engine block and aluminum cylinder heads that have centrally mounted spark plugs. Are there any problems with the Ford V10? What does IWE solenoid stand for?

What does IWE solenoid stand for? IWE stands for "Integrated Wheel Ends". And yes the line coming off the engine T's off and one end goes to the vacuum box and the other feeds the solenoid. It doesnt activate the solenoid it just feeds the solenoid with the vacuum to supply it down to the actuators at the wheels. What does a hub locking solenoid do? The IWE Solenoid/Valve Assembly (part# 7L1Z-9H465-B), which controls the flow of vacuum when you change drives.
